Job description

Based at our Headington campus and reporting to the Deputy Director of Finance (Financial Analysis and Planning), the Head of Finance and Planning (Partnerships and Costing) will be responsible for ensuring the financial sustainability of the University's UK and international educational partnerships. This senior role will oversee the costing, evaluation, and monitoring of the University's educational portfolio, applying Full Economic Costing (FEC) principles to inform strategic decision-making. Working closely with senior leaders, including the Pro Vice-Chancellors and the Head of Educational Partnerships, the post holder will lead on business case development, support commercial negotiations, and provide high-quality financial analysis and reporting to governance committees. With responsibility for managing and developing a small team, championing sector best practice, and representing the CFO in key internal and external forums, this role offers the opportunity to shape the University's approach to income diversification, value for money, and long-term financial sustainability.

This is a full-time post, but a fractional post of 0.8FTE or above will be considered.

The Financial Planning & Analysis department plays a central role in driving the University's financial sustainability and supporting decision-making across all Faculties, Directorates, and strategic partnerships. We are responsible for delivering high-quality management information, financial planning, budgeting, forecasting, and insightful analysis to senior leaders, enabling them to make informed, data-driven decisions.
